Speed SensorResistance

  1. Check that the sensor installation bolt is tightened properly. If not tighten the boltto specification. See TORQUE SPECIFICATIONS .
  2. Disconnect the speed sensor connector.
  3. Measure the resistance between terminals. The resistance should be 580-700 ohms. If resistance value is not as specified, replace the sensor.
  4. Check that there is no continuity between each terminal and sensor body. If there is continuity replace the sensor.
  5. Connect the speed sensor connector.
